Concrete Refinishing in Frisco, TX
Concrete refinishing services involve restoring and enhancing existing concrete surfaces to improve their appearance and durability. This process can be applied to a variety of projects, including driveways, patios, walkways, garage floors, and basement slabs. Property owners typically seek concrete refinishing to repair surface damage, such as cracks or stains, and to achieve a fresh, uniform look through techniques like staining, overlays, or polishing. Understanding the current condition of the concrete, the desired finish, and any specific aesthetic or functional goals are important considerations before requesting refinishing services.
Homeowners often want to know about the different finishing options available, the types of surface treatments suitable for their specific project, and the expected results. It’s also helpful to consider the existing concrete’s age, condition, and usage to determine the best approach. Clarifying these details can ensure that the refinishing process meets both aesthetic preferences and practical needs, resulting in a durable, attractive surface that enhances the property's overall appeal.

Common Concrete Refinishing Jobs
Concrete patio refinishing - revitalizes outdoor spaces with smooth, durable surfaces.
Garage floor resurfacing - improves appearance and protects concrete from wear and stains.
Driveway restoration - enhances curb appeal by repairing cracks and uneven areas.
Basement floor refinishing - creates a clean, polished look for finished or unfinished spaces.
Pool deck resurfacing - provides a slip-resistant, attractive surface around pools.
Concrete step refinishing - increases safety and aesthetic appeal of entryways and stairs.
Concrete Refinishing Questions
What is concrete refinishing? Concrete refinishing involves applying a new surface layer or coating to improve the appearance and durability of existing concrete surfaces.
Which areas can benefit from concrete refinishing? Driveways, patios, walkways, and garage floors are common projects for concrete refinishing to enhance aesthetics and longevity.
What types of finishes are available? Options include staining, epoxy coatings, overlays, and polished finishes to achieve various looks and textures.
Is concrete refinishing suitable for damaged surfaces? Yes, it can conceal minor cracks and surface imperfections, restoring a smooth and attractive appearance.
